要集成Java工作流框架,首先需要选择一个适合的工作流框架,比如流行的 Activiti、Camunda、JBPM 等。然后按照以下步骤进行集成:
- 在项目中引入工作流框架的依赖:在项目的 pom.xml 文件中添加相应的依赖,如 Activiti 的依赖如下所示:
org.activiti activiti-spring-boot-starter-basic 7.1.0.M1
-
配置工作流引擎:根据工作流框架的文档,配置工作流引擎,包括数据库连接、流程定义、流程实例等配置。
-
编写流程定义:使用工作流框架提供的 API 或图形化工具,编写流程定义文件,定义流程中的节点、任务、连线等元素。
-
集成到应用中:在应用中调用工作流框架的 API,启动流程实例、查询任务、完成任务等操作。
-
监控和管理流程:集成工作流框架的监控和管理功能,实时查看流程状态、处理异常、优化流程等。
通过以上步骤,就可以成功集成Java工作流框架,实现业务流程的管理和优化。需要根据具体的工作流框架和项目需求进行详细的配置和开发。